Leveraging Variations for A/B Testing
One of the most compelling applications of this functionality lies in A/B testing. By creating multiple versions of an ad headline, email subject line, or website call to action, businesses can objectively measure which version performs best. This allows for continuous optimization and refinement of marketing materials, leading to improved conversion rates and a higher return on investment. A/B testing isn't merely about identifying the “winning” variation; it's about gaining valuable insights into customer preferences and motivations. The data collected during testing can inform future content creation efforts, ensuring that messaging remains relevant and impactful.
It's important to note that A/B testing isn’t a one-time event. The market is in constant flux, and customer preferences evolve over time. Therefore, continuous testing and optimization are essential for maintaining a competitive edge. Furthermore, A/B testing should be approached with a clear hypothesis in mind. For example, “We believe that a headline incorporating a sense of urgency will generate a higher click-through rate.” This allows for more meaningful data analysis and informed decision-making.
| Metric | Description | Importance |
|---|---|---|
| Click-Through Rate (CTR) | Percentage of users who click on a link. | High |
| Conversion Rate | Percentage of users who complete a desired action. | High |
| Bounce Rate | Percentage of users who leave a website after viewing only one page. | Medium |
| Time on Page | Average amount of time users spend on a page. | Medium |
Understanding these key metrics and tracking them consistently is vital to ensuring successful deployment of content variations. The platform often integrates with analytics tools, facilitating easy monitoring and analysis of performance data.

Content Repurposing Strategies
The ability to quickly generate variations also facilitates content repurposing – the practice of transforming a single piece of content into multiple formats. A blog post can be converted into an infographic, a video script, or a series of social media posts. This extends the reach of the original content and maximizes its impact. Content repurposing is a highly efficient way to generate value from existing assets. It also reinforces brand messaging and builds thought leadership over time.
Effective content repurposing requires a clear understanding of the target audience and their preferred content formats. For example, if your audience is highly visual, focusing on creating infographics and videos might be a good strategy. If your audience prefers in-depth analysis, long-form blog posts and white papers might be more effective. The key is to provide value in a format that resonates with your audience.
- Identify your core content themes.
- Determine the most effective content formats for each platform.
- Automate the content adaptation process whenever possible.
- Track the performance of repurposed content and make adjustments as needed.
By systematically repurposing content, businesses can amplify their message and reach a wider audience without significantly increasing their content creation workload.

Limitations and Ethical Considerations
While powerful, there are limitations to consider when utilizing these AI tools. The generated content can sometimes lack originality or fail to capture the nuanced voice of a brand. Plagiarism is a potential concern, especially if the source material is not properly vetted. It's imperative to always check generated content for originality using plagiarism detection tools. Ethical considerations also come into play. Transparently disclosing the use of AI-generated content is important to maintain trust with your audience. The platform shouldn’t be used to create deceptive or misleading content. It should enhance, not replace, human creativity and ethical content creation practices.
Furthermore, over-reliance on AI-generated content can stifle creativity and lead to homogenization of messaging. It’s important to strike a balance between leveraging the efficiency of AI and preserving the unique voice and personality of your brand. Human input remains vital in ensuring that content is engaging, authentic, and aligned with your overall marketing goals.
- Always review AI-generated content for accuracy and originality.
- Disclose the use of AI when appropriate.
- Maintain a focus on ethical content creation practices.
- Don't solely rely on AI; leverage human creativity and expertise.
These steps help to ensure that the use of AI enhances, rather than detracts from, the overall quality and integrity of your content.
